Srinagar: 35 more people tested positive for COVID-19 on Sunday; the tally has surpassed the 700-mark.
The Department of Information and Public Relations informed that 35 more people tested positive while 33 recovered. Among the total, 640 are from Kashmir and 61 from Jammu.
Government’s spokesman, Rohit Kansal, said that the Jammu and Kashmir has increased the testing capacity, with over 2500 people were tested in a day.
Currently, the country is locked down till 17 May to contain the spread of COVID-19.
